Position: Airport Ramp Agent - Lihue - Full-Time (5k Sign-On Bonus)

Role Summary

The Ramp Agent is responsible for loading and offloading guests’ baggage, ensuring items are accounted for and well taken care of. They also look out for the safety and well‑being of each other while ensuring our flights arrive and depart on time. This is a union represented position.

Key Duties
  • Loading, stowing and unloading of all cargo and baggage in accordance with flight loading plans.
  • Pick‑up and delivery of all cargo, including mail, express, baggage, freight company material, commissary supplies.
  • Preparation, reporting and accounting of necessary documents relating to work performed.
  • Cleaning of aircraft baggage pits and immediate work areas.
  • Operation of automotive equipment in connection with the above duties, and only after proper training.
  • Insert and remove chocks and safety lines.
  • When mechanical personnel are not immediately available, may receive and dispatch aircraft.
  • May also be required to perform the duties of Cleaners: limited to cleaning of offices in surrounding areas and aircraft. Such duties may be assigned only as the needs of the service require.
Job-Specific Experience, Education & Skills

Required Qualifications
  • Must be willing and able to work outside in the elements.
  • Ability to lift 70lbs throughout your shift.
  • Must be able to bend, stoop, squat, reach and grasp.
  • Must be willing and able to work in confined spaces on knees/elbows, lifting baggage overhead frequently (weighing 70+ lbs.), operating heavy machinery near the aircraft, driving tugs, and more.
  • Must have a valid unexpired driver’s license issued by a US state, a US territory or the District of Columbia.
  • Flexible to work varied shifts including nights, weekends, and holidays.
  • Ability to obtain USPS Mail Handling Certification.
  • Ability to obtain airport security clearance.
  • Ability to communicate in English.
  • High school diploma or equivalent.
  • Minimum age of 18.
  • Must be authorized to work in the U.S.

Airport SIDA Badge Requirements

Employees working at an airport or maintenance hangar must obtain an SIDA badge provided by the airport authority and maintain good standing to keep their badge. If an employee does not qualify for or has a SIDA badge pulled, the employee will be terminated.

Regulatory

Information

Alaska Airlines, Hawaiian Airlines & Horizon Air are regulated by the Department of Transportation (DOT – regulations, 49 CFR part 40) and all applicants are advised that post‑offer and/or pre‑employment drug testing will be conducted to determine the presence of marijuana, cocaine, opioids, phencyclidine (PCP) and amphetamines or a metabolite of these drugs prior to any offer or employment or transfer into a safety‑sensitive position.

Failure to submit to testing or positive indications of drug use will render the applicant ineligible for employment.
